Bob Scheifler wrote: >> Example: I have a subject with Principal A, B en C and out of those 3 >> principals I want to be sure that when I authenticates to the server it >> must use A. In this case I think both Min(A) and Max(A) will have the >> same net effect (my original question), am I right here? > > Yes. > >> But in case both A and C are both allowed [1] for client authentication >> should I configure Max(A, C) or should I use a >> ConstraintAlternatives(Min(A), Min(C)). > > Either way should work.
